**The escalating scale of space launch programs threatens stratospheric ozone depletion and alters radiative forcing, complicating earth-bound nature-based carbon sequestration baselines. **

  • Rocket launches emit black carbon directly into the stratosphere, persisting longer than tropospheric emissions and accelerating warming that stresses fragile terrestrial ecosystems.
